A lien is a legal claim against a property that ensures a debt is paid. If the debt remains unpaid, the lien may lead to options such as enforcement or sale to recover the amount owed.
Key elements include the creditor, the debtor, the secured debt, and the recorded lien. The process typically involves notices, filings, deadlines, and possible enforcement actions.

In short, a property lien is a legal claim against real estate to secure payment. It can affect the ability to sell or refinance until resolved. The right steps include reviewing the lien, negotiating payment terms, and pursuing lawful remedies if the lien is improper.
California law provides deadlines for challenging liens and for pursuing certain remedies. Acting within these timelines helps protect your rights. We can assess your timeline and outline practical options.
Yes, depending on the context and accuracy of the lien, challenges or removals may be possible through court or administrative processes. A careful review of documents and facts is essential.
